Choosing the appropriate property program
Start with your clinical needs, not marketing web pages. Ask 3 core questions. Initially, what level of medical assistance do you require, specifically for detoxification. Second, what co-occurring conditions need energetic administration. Third, what kind of restorative culture assists you engage.
Detox. Alcohol, benzodiazepine, and opioid withdrawal can be clinically risky. Validate that the center has 24 hr nursing and a physician that sees people consistently throughout detoxification. Ask about signs and symptom tracking, use of evidence based withdrawal scales, and accessibility to higher care if problems occur. In Texas, some residential programs sit on a larger clinical university, while others coordinate with neighboring healthcare facilities. Know which model you are entering.
Co-occurring mental health and wellness. If you have anxiety, PTSD, bipolar illness, or ADHD, confirm the program treats dual medical diagnosis. Ask whether they carry site psychiatric prescribing, just how often you will see that supplier, and whether they proceed existing drugs or prefer to taper and reestablish. For trauma, inquire about EMDR or various other injury focused therapies. For energetic psychosis or unstable mania, a psychological stablizing device might be the first stop prior to residential addiction treatment.
Therapeutic culture. Texas has a variety of approaches, from 12 step immersion to CBT and motivational talking to, from belief inclusive teams to clearly Christian tracks, from adventure treatment to silent, skills based days. Go to ideally, even for an hour. If you are picking addiction treatment in San Antonio, make the most of closeness to tour 2 or 3 programs personally. When distance makes brows through impractical, request a digital walk through. Take note of the flow of a day, staff to person ratio, and how clients engage with personnel between sessions.
Medication for addiction treatment. Plans differ. Some Texas household programs totally sustain buprenorphine, expanded release naltrexone, and, with coordination with an opioid treatment program, methadone. Others like antagonist treatment just, or will certainly swear in but tip down quickly. Clarify this beforehand. If you have actually been stable on buprenorphine, you do not want to uncover on admission that the program demands tapering.
Length of remain and end results. The old 28 day requirement is a rough beginning factor, not a rule. Many residential remains now run 21 to 45 days, adjusted to clinical need and insurance coverage. Be wary of ensured end results. Instead, request their conclusion prices, average size of remain, and aftercare engagement rates. A program that constructs aftercare early often tends to support much better long-term results.
Navigating insurance, cost, and paperwork
Money inquiries are emotional. Naming them early reduces surprises. Start with verification of benefits. Your program's admissions workplace can run it, but request a duplicate in writing. Confirm your insurance deductible, carbon monoxide insurance, expense maximum, and whether the facility is in network. If it is out of network, ask about a solitary instance agreement. Some Texas plans, consisting of several employer funded plans, will accredit out of network treatment when in network options are inaccessible or otherwise medically appropriate.
Preauthorization. For the majority of business strategies, domestic levels of treatment call for preauthorization. That suggests medical notes must be sent before admission and often again after a few days to warrant ongoing stay. Ask the program that deals with these evaluations. A good usage testimonial group is as vital as good therapists.
Parity and protections. Federal parity regulation calls for most health insurance to treat addiction treatment on par with medical-surgical treatment. If you hit obstacles that do not make sense, such as a plan that covers inpatient surgical treatment but rejects clinically essential property detoxification, ask the program to assist you escalate. If you are uninsured or self pay, ask for a good confidence price quote of costs as allowed under government legislation. Several facilities will certainly establish a per day price or a bundled rate, and some supply payment plans.
Time off work. Employers are utilized to FMLA ask for clinical fallen leaves, consisting of addiction treatment. If you have actually been with a protected employer for a minimum of one year and fulfill hours thresholds, FMLA can safeguard your work for approximately 12 weeks of overdue leave. Short-term handicap, when available, might replace component of your income. Your program can generally supply an admission letter, therapy strategy updates, and a physical fitness for responsibility note at discharge. Texas does not have actually a statewide paid leave program, so you may rely on company plans, accumulated PTO, or disability coverage.
Legal and court problems. If you are on probation or have pending costs associated with material use, educate your attorney or probation policeman and obtain written support about treatment presence, interaction with the court, and any medicine screening needs. Many judges in Texas sight documented domestic therapy positively, specifically when you total and follow online addiction treatment up with aftercare. The key is transparency and timely updates.
What to manage in your home before you go
Successful admissions typically come down to unglamorous logistics. Costs still turn up. Pet dogs require feeding. Children need plans. If family members gets on board, appoint certain functions rather than really hoping somebody will certainly cover every little thing. Compose it down. The mental relief of understanding these little yet hefty rocks are set aside commonly shows up in better involvement throughout the initial week.
Housing and expenses. Establish autopay for rental fee or home mortgage, utilities, automobile insurance policy, and phone service. If you can not set autopay, placed due dates on a common calendar with a relied on person. If your lease is month to month and you anticipate to be gone beyond the revival date, alert your property manager in creating that an assigned person can manage urgent issues while you are away.
Children and dependents. Develop an authorized caregiver consent where ideal. Colleges in Texas usually accept a short-term caregiver note for routine matters, however unique education and learning services or medical choices may call for even more formal documentation. Leave copies of vaccination records and insurance cards.
Pets. Set up feeding, walking, and veterinary backups. Many programs will certainly not permit pets on school other than certified service animals. If your drug addiction treatment animal is a service pet, communicate early and offer paperwork that satisfies ADA standards.

Phones and contact. Many residential programs limit phone usage during the first week. Inform close get in touches with when you will certainly be mostly inaccessible and just how they will certainly speak with you. Many Texas programs have actually arranged family members calls or weekend sessions. Establishing that assumption now prevents panic later.
A short list of files to gather
- A government ID and your insurance coverage card, physical or digital
- A present medication checklist with specific doses, prescriber names, and pharmacy
- Contact info for your primary care, specialist, and any type of specialists
- Legal files that impact your treatment, such as probation terms or custodianship orders
- Signed releases of info so team can collaborate with family members, employers, or lawful contacts
Medications and medical readiness
Detox and stablizing go much better when team have tidy case histories and accurate drug listings. Bring pill containers in their original drug store containers if possible. If you receive controlled medications, such as energizers or benzodiazepines, anticipate a cautious testimonial. Some drugs may be held during detox to prevent complications, then reintroduced. If you make use of a CPAP maker, bring it. If you have diabetes, ask just how the program handles insulin storage space and surveillance. Programs vary in exactly how they manage upkeep medications like methadone and buprenorphine. Some can dosage on site, others collaborate transportation to a partner facility. Clarify this prior to day one so you do not miss out on doses.
Allergies, adverse responses, and previous withdrawal complications ought to be front and facility. If you have had a seizure from alcohol withdrawal, or serious blood pressure swings, state so throughout pre admission testing. If you have a background of ecstasy tremens, you need to remain in a program with strong clinical oversight. Do not decrease signs to get in faster. The best match defeats a hurried admission that finishes with a preventable transfer.
Vaccination and infection testing plans differ. After 2020, numerous Texas programs adopted conventional respiratory system ailment testing and might ask about influenza or COVID vaccination status. This typically influences cohorting and masking more than admission itself. Honesty helps team protect you and your peers.
What to pack and what to leave
Pack as if you are going to an organized hideaway with everyday movement, group rooms maintained a touch cooler than you anticipate, and outside time in Texas weather.
- Three to five days of comfortable, climate ideal clothes, including layers
- Closed toe shoes for teams and one pair of athletic shoes for strolls or light exercise
- Basic toiletries in unopened containers, alcohol totally free when possible
- A little journal and a simple watch, given that phones are usually restricted
- A list of vital phone numbers written on paper
Do not load huge amounts of cash money, expensive precious jewelry, or anything flammable, including aerosol sprays and colognes with high alcohol material. Leave weapons at home. Lots of centers limit power drinks, supplements, and over-the-counter drugs unless approved by medical personnel. Vapes and e cigarettes might be outlawed or constrained to certain locations. If you use nicotine, inquire about patches or gum on admission to avoid a rough very first week.

Preparing your mindset
A straightforward mental stock aids. Residential treatment timetables move from analysis to detox stabilization to abilities acquisition quickly. Anticipate to have much less control over your day than you do in the house. Expect responses, often blunt. Expect peers who are not like you. Devote to inquisitiveness. If a team technique is strange, tell the facilitator what throws you off and what aids you lean in.
Homesickness, also if you are just 30 miles away, is typical around days three to five. Rest is strange during detoxification for many individuals. Hunger can take a week to stabilize. Yearnings surge and drop. Team have seen it all. Share what is occurring instead of muscling through. Every time you speak out, you pile the deck in your favor.
If belief is essential to you, look for a program that can honor it without compeling it. If identification safety and security issues, ask pointed concerns concerning LGBTQ attesting techniques, language gain access to, and injury educated care. The best fit is much less concerning design and more concerning mental safety and security, clearness of assumptions, and the program's capacity to match strength to your needs.
What the first day in fact looks like
Admissions in Texas look more comparable than different. You will sign in, sign permissions, abandonment limited items, and satisfy nursing for vitals and a fast physical. You will examine your substance use history and clinical history, commonly twice, when for admissions and as soon as for nursing. Lab work may include an urine medication display and basic blood examinations. If you are entering detoxification, drug orders adhere to within hours, changed as your signs and symptoms evolve.
A therapist will orient you to the daily routine. Morning meal, early morning community meeting, two to three group sessions, specific treatment weekly or more often, family members call structured into afternoons or weekend breaks, evening recovery activities. Physical fitness or entertainment could be a daily stroll, light fitness center time, yoga, or art. Phones are typically held throughout the very first week. Sees usually begin after the detox stage, but family education and learning can begin sooner.
The opening night is hardly ever peaceful. New seems, a brand-new bed, very early wake times. Request for earplugs. Request an extra covering. People that ask for practical conveniences adjust faster.
Work, college, and privacy
Texas companies see clinical leaves for addiction treatment consistently. Still, stigma exists. You manage what your alcohol addiction treatment paperwork states. Clinical notes can reference inpatient medical care without detailing a diagnosis. If your business has a Staff member Aid Program, think about looping them in for an added layer of support and privacy. Institutions and colleges are often flexible if you provide main documentation of a medical leave. For college students in San Antonio, the majority of registrars will certainly enable a medical withdrawal with prorated tuition adjustments when documentation is timely. Ask your expert to aid you position a go back to campus with an adjusted load.
Privacy in addiction treatment has added protection under federal regulation that restricts sharing of substance use therapy records without your composed authorization. Programs will ask you to authorize launches so they can coordinate with family or employers. Read those forms. You can customize what info moves where.

Life after residential beginnings now
Good programs speak about discharge on day two. That is not a tip you will be hurried out. It is an indicator they take connection seriously. Ask how they make aftercare. In Texas, a common step down is partial hospitalization for one to 2 weeks, after that intensive outpatient for six to twelve weeks, paired with specific treatment and, if handy, healing mentoring. Sober living is a strong alternative when your home environment is chaotic or when you desire structured accountability.
If you are anchored in San Antonio, draw up aftercare before you finish detox. Schedule intake appointments. Go to a sober living house if that remains in the plan. Loophole in your health care provider so medicine administration does not fail the cracks. If you are returning to a smaller town, consider maintaining your IOP in a larger city for a period. Telehealth IOPs can function if they consist of normal drug screening and solid group cohesion, however lots of people do much better with face to face treatment at the very least initially.
Transportation is part of aftercare. If you shed your license because of a DWI, get straightforward about how you will attend groups. Carpooling with peers appears practical, yet it can become its very own trigger if you begin avoiding with each other. Some programs companion with rideshare vouchers or regional nonprofits. Ask.
A short word on special populations
Military and veterans. Programs around San Antonio comprehend chain of command, accounts, and return to responsibility assessments. Clear up early how your command will certainly be notified and what documents is needed. Many units sustain treatment, but timing and interaction design matter.
Pregnant clients. Pick a program with obstetric backup and experience handling withdrawal in pregnancy. Detox methods should be customized. Coordination with prenatal care is essential.
Adolescents and young people. Approval, institution control, and family members treatment bring added weight. Texas has fewer property beds for teenagers than for adults. If a waitlist exists, inquire about acting safety planning and outpatient supports.
Chronic discomfort. Integrated plans that use non opioid techniques, mindful physical treatment, and, when required, medicine assisted treatment can shield both discomfort control and healing. Clarify plans around gabapentinoids and muscle relaxants. These are typically restricted in residential settings.
Common mistakes and exactly how to avoid them
Trying to manage every variable. Also one of the most arranged admissions have a shock. Approve that you will certainly not prepare for everything. Concentrate on essentials.
Letting pity hold-up admission. If a bed is offered and you prepare, go. Waiting for an ideal home window usually leads to a return to use.
Not informing the complete story. Underreporting alcohol intake or benzodiazepine usage can turn detox harmful. Be specific, even if it is uncomfortable.
Ignoring aftercare. Residential therapy is a reset, not a finish line. People who leave without a clear plan, consultations arranged, and a support network involved have a much harder first 90 days.
